Independence joins Encounter Resources as new partner to advance Paterson copper-cobalt exploration

The directors of Encounter Resources Ltd (Encounter) have welcomed Independence Group NL (IGO) as a new major shareholder and partner in advancing the Yeneena copper-cobalt project in the Paterson province of Western Australia.

IGO has subscribed for a placement of 24 million ordinary shares at a price AUS$0.075 – a 60% premium to 20 trading day VWAP - to raise a total of AUS$1.8 million. Encounter shall apply a minimum of 80% of the funds raised towards advancing Yeneena. The placement will be completed pursuant to the company’s 15% placement capacity under ASX Listing Rule 7.1.

A technical committee will be formed with equal representation from Encounter and IGO to design exploration activities at Yeneena. At any time before 1 March 2020, IGO may elect to enter an earn-in agreement to spend up to AUS$15 million to earn a 70% interest in Yeneena.

As a result of the placement and earn-in option, Encounter’s copper-cobalt exploration in the Paterson Province will be well funded and progressing with a highly successful partner. This complements Encounter’s high quality gold portfolio in three of Australia’s most prospective gold regions: the Tanami (via five 50:50 joint ventures with Newcrest Mining Ltd), the Paterson province and the Laverton tectonic zone.

Commenting on the IGO partnership, Encounter Managing Director, Will Robinson, said: “IGO is a highly successful exploration and mining company. Their support for Encounter is confirmation of the quality of Encounter’s exploration team, strategy and portfolio of projects. The Paterson Province is a prime location for copper-cobalt discoveries in Australia. Recent activity by a number of major mining houses highlights and validates the enormous potential of the region. We are delighted to be working alongside the highly respected IGO team to advance large-scale copper-cobalt opportunities along this 70 km long corridor.”

Yeneena copper-cobalt project

A major strategic land holding (1250 km2) in the emerging Proterozoic Paterson province covering a 70 km long corridor south of Nifty. The Paterson province is a proven mineral region with a consistent history of discoveries and with increasingly active majors.
